SEVEN WEEKS TO NEW COUNCIL DEVELOPMENT SUCCESS

After meeting with the pastor and securing his permission to proceed with the formation of a Knights of Columbus council in his parish - DEVELOP A PLAN!

The following is not the only way, but a supplement to the New Council development guidelines that will have you achieving new council development in just
Seven Weeks.

 

 

red horizontal line

 

WEEK 1

  • Set a target date for your informational meetings and the new council's institution.

  • Send in the Notice of Intent to Establish a Council (Form #133) to the state deputy for processing. When we receive the Form #133 we will send you a New Council Development Canvasser's Kit from the Supreme Council office, which contains all the information and materials you will need to start the council.

  • Contact your state's new council development chairman and your general agent - the will help!

  • Arrange to show one of the Order's audiovisual productions at your organizational meetings. "Experience of a Lifetime", the Order's recruitment film (in kit) or "The Life and Legacy of Father McGivney", are ideal for showing at this meeting. Be sure to order films from the Supreme Council Department of Fraternal Services at least three weeks ahead of time.

  • Place an announcement of the formation of a Knights of Columbus council in the parish bulletin.

WEEK 2

  • Place an announcement of your first informational meeting in the parish bulletin. Be sure to invite wives to the meeting.

  • Hold a church drive, be sure to have members on hand to distribute literature after all the Masses. (Pamphlets are available in the Canvasser's Kit.)

  • Hold an informational meeting with a complete agenda - perhaps like the following:

    • Explain the structure of the Knights of Columbus (Supreme, state and local).

    • Programming (Church, community, council, family, and youth).

    • Present an explanation of the Order's insurance program and the benefits available, use a member of the agency force.

    • Audiovisual presentation.

    • Pass out two membership documents to each member - one for him to complete before he leaves, the other for him to use in signing up a new member.

 

 

red horizontal line

 

 

WEEK 3

  • Place a write-up in the parish bulletin announcing the second informational meting for the following week.

  • Contact all the men that attended the first meeting and encourage them to attend the second meeting with a friend or relative.

 

 

 

red horizontal line

 

 

WEEK 4

  • Hold the second informational meeting and conduct a First Degree for the candidates that are signed up. (There is no need to wait for all 30 candidates before holding a degree.)

  • Start discussing the election of council officers.

 

 

 

red horizontal line

 

WEEK 5

  • Place an announcement in the parish bulletin publicizing a third informational meeting, admission degree, and election of the council's first officers.

  • Notify all candidates that need to take their First Degree and urge them to attend the next meeting.

  • Notify all members of the new council of the meeting and election of council officers.

 

 

 

red horizontal line

 

WEEK 6

  • Hold information meting for all new candidates if necessary.

  • Conduct a First Degree for remaining candidates.

  • Elect the charter officers for the new council.

  • Decide on a council name.

  • Place an announcement in the parish bulletin about the formation of a new Knights of Columbus council in the parish, along with the up-coming installation of council officers.

 

 

 

red horizontal line

 

 

WEEK 7

COUNCIL IF FORMED!!

  • Hold an installation of officers - make sure to invite wives and families to this ceremony.
